varrásban
Varrásban is a Hungarian grammatical form derived from the noun varrás (the act or process of sewing) with the inessive suffix -ban, meaning “in sewing” or “in the act of sewing.” It functions as a noun-based phrase indicating location or state within stitching, and is used primarily in descriptive or technical writing rather than everyday speech.
